CURTIS BA I UR Curt “Footlight Glamour” Curt has been a great prop to our class. His “go ahead” abil- ity has helped to put through many successful events of the class. He is a very good speaker and was chosen to represent us in the oratorical contest. His interest in the contest in- creased greatly it is said, as he became a close second to the Saratoga contestant, a blue-eyed, fair-skinned “femme.” It’s too bad Curt isn’t following a career in dramatics as he has shown great abilities in school plays. No one could have played the part of the villain so successfully as Curt. Because of his energetic spirit he will go far in the work he has chosen —forestry, in which he became very interested as an Eagle in the Boy Scouts. -11 --I2—Joyyec Basketball. Junior Tennis. Varsity Baseball. Schuyler Start', Service Club. MARY ROOTH —“Boothie” “Johnny Come Lately” Mary wore pigtails the longest of any girl in her class. She did not have them sheared until her junior year. We don’t blame her for keeping them as long as possible as she had very pretty long braids. Her fondness for long hair reminds one of another preference. . .cokes taste a lot better down- street when you are excused from school for an important errand, don’t they, Mary? Although she followed a homemaking course throughout high school, she thinks she wants to become a beautician. The homemaking course will always be beneficial as I imagine she will eventually become a good wife. 41-42—Secretary Freshman Km. 11 Junior Hijch Intrn- nurals.
